Employee Detailed View in an HR Management Software
An employee detailed view in HR management software provides a centralized hub for all relevant information about an employee. This can be used for various purposes, including:
- HR Administration: Efficiently manage employee records, update information, and track changes over time.
- Performance Management: Assess employee performance, set goals, and provide feedback.
- Payroll Processing: Accurately calculate salaries, deductions, and benefits based on employee information.
- Compliance: Ensure compliance with labor laws and regulations by maintaining accurate employee records.
- Reporting: Generate reports on employee data for analysis and decision-making.
- Employee Self-Service: Allow employees to access and update their own information, reducing administrative burden.
It includes various details like:
Personal Information:
- Name: Full name of the employee.
- Contact Details: Address, phone number, email address, and other relevant contact information.
- Date of Birth: Birthdate of the employee.
- Gender: Gender identity.
- Emergency Contact Information: Contact details of a person to be notified in case of an emergency.
Work Information:
- Job Title: The employee’s official position within the organization.
- Department: The department or team the employee belongs to.
- Start Date: The date when the employee joined the company.
- Salary: The employee’s salary and any applicable benefits.
- Performance Reviews: Records of performance evaluations and feedback.
- Goals and Objectives: The employee’s key performance indicators and goals.
Bank Information:
- Bank Name: The name of the bank where the employee’s salary is deposited.
- Account Number: The employee’s bank account number.
Requests:
- Leave Requests: Tracks and manages vacation, sick leave, and other absence requests.
- Shift Requests: Manages requests for shift changes or adjustments.
- Time Off Requests: Tracks requests for time off or breaks.
- Expense Claims: Manages expense reimbursement requests.
- Training Requests: Tracks requests for training and development.
- Other Requests: Can be customized to include other types of requests as needed.
